So, Dana and I just got back from a great little weekend up in Solvang.  We’ll have a full post with pictures coming later in the week.  For now, I just say, that for the first time in, probably close to 7 or 8 trips to Solvang, I finally found and ate the Aebelskiver!

Now, for those of you who have never heard of an Aebelskiver (and I don’t blame you, I’ve never seen them outside of Solvang), it is basically a pancake type ball of dough that has been cooked, topped with jam, and some powdered sugar.
